An Operational Semantics of Real-Time Process Algebra (RTPA)

被引:1
作者
Wang, Yingxu [1 ]
Ngolah, Cyprian F. [1 ,2 ]
机构
[1] Univ Calgary, Calgary, AB, Canada
[2] Univ Buea, Buea, Cameroon
基金
加拿大自然科学与工程研究理事会;
关键词
cognitive informatics; operational semantics; RTPA; real -tune process algebra; real-time systems; software engineering; reduction machine;
D O I
10.4018/jcini.2008070106
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
The need for new forms of mathematics to express software engineering concepts and entities has been widely recognized. Real-time process algebra (RTPA) is a denotational mathematical stricture and a system modeling methodoloAy for describing the architectures and behaviors of real-time and nonreal-time software systems. This article presents an operational semantics of RTPA, which explains how syntactic constructs in RTPA can be reduced to values on an abstract-reduction machine. The operational semantics of RIPA provides a comprehensive paradigm offormal semantics that establishes an entire set of operational semantic rules of software. RTPA has been successfully applied in real-world system modeling and code generation for software systems, human cognitive processes, and intelligent systems.
引用
收藏
页码:71 / 89
页数:19
相关论文
共 50 条
  • [31] Compounded Real-Time Operating Systems for Rich Real-Time Applications
    Yang, Chung-Fan
    Shinjo, Yasushi
    IEEE ACCESS, 2025, 13 : 26079 - 26104
  • [32] Operational Semantics of Business Process Description Model Supported by Answer Set
    Zheng, Yunxiang
    Wan, Hai
    2012 INTERNATIONAL CONFERENCE ON FUTURE INFORMATION TECHNOLOGY AND MANAGEMENT SCIENCE & ENGINEERING (FITMSE 2012), 2012, 14 : 569 - 574
  • [33] A Real-Time Quality Control System Based on Manufacturing Process Data
    Duan, Gui-Jiang
    Yan, Xin
    IEEE ACCESS, 2020, 8 : 208506 - 208517
  • [34] Real-time specifications
    Alexandre David
    Kim G. Larsen
    Axel Legay
    Ulrik Nyman
    Louis-Marie Traonouez
    Andrzej Wąsowski
    International Journal on Software Tools for Technology Transfer, 2015, 17 : 17 - 45
  • [35] Real-time specifications
    David, Alexandre
    Larsen, Kim G.
    Legay, Axel
    Nyman, Ulrik
    Traonouez, Louis-Marie
    Wasowski, Andrzej
    INTERNATIONAL JOURNAL ON SOFTWARE TOOLS FOR TECHNOLOGY TRANSFER, 2015, 17 (01) : 17 - 45
  • [36] Formal description of time management in real-time operating systems
    Rusu-Banu, Fabricio
    Wang, Yingxu
    2006 CANADIAN CONFERENCE ON ELECTRICAL AND COMPUTER ENGINEERING, VOLS 1-5, 2006, : 1801 - +
  • [37] A generic component framework for real-time control
    Griph, FS
    Hogben, CHA
    Buckley, MA
    IEEE TRANSACTIONS ON NUCLEAR SCIENCE, 2004, 51 (03) : 558 - 564
  • [38] The real-time task scheduling algorithm of RTOS
    Ngolah, CF
    Wang, YX
    Tan, XM
    CANADIAN JOURNAL OF ELECTRICAL AND COMPUTER ENGINEERING-REVUE CANADIENNE DE GENIE ELECTRIQUE ET INFORMATIQUE, 2004, 29 (04): : 237 - 243
  • [39] Electric Loads as Real-Time tasks: an application of Real-Time Physical Systems
    Della Vedova, Marco L.
    di Palma, Ettore
    Facchinetti, Tullio
    2011 7TH INTERNATIONAL WIRELESS COMMUNICATIONS AND MOBILE COMPUTING CONFERENCE (IWCMC), 2011, : 1117 - 1123
  • [40] A barred operational semantics for a subset of WS-CDL with time restrictions
    Valero, Valentin
    Diaz, Gregorio
    Emilia Cambronero, Maria
    Macia, Hermenegilda
    JOURNAL OF LOGIC AND ALGEBRAIC PROGRAMMING, 2009, 78 (08): : 730 - 748